Please Welcome Our Newest Member, New Hope Midcoast!


New Hope Midcoast offers support to people in Sagadahoc, Lincoln, Knox and Waldo counties affected by domestic and dating violence and provides educational resources to assist our communities in creating a safer and healthier future.


New Hope Midcoast believes that the misuse of power to demean or control others fosters oppression and violence. This manifests itself as racism, sexism, classism, homophobia, religious bigotry, domestic abuse and other forms of violence. New Hope Midcoast believes that a just and peaceful society must commit itself to confronting and overcoming all forms of oppression and violence.

Please Welcome Our Newest Member, Joe Wardwell of The Christopher Group!


Joe has dedicated his entire career to helping people. He was born and raised in Castine and Penobscot. Joe attended George Stevens Academy in Blue Hill for high school. After high school he earned his Paramedic certificate at Northeastern University in Burlington, MA then quickly returned to the area he loves. He has been a Firefighter/Paramedic for the City of Bangor for 27 years and is currently a Fire Captain. He also dedicated 30 years of service to Peninsula Ambulance in Blue Hill where he started as a driver while still in high school. Joe holds an associate's degree in both Fire Science from EMCC and Legal Technologies from UMO.


In 2019 Joe started his journey in real estate. His knowledge of the Penobscot River towns and Coastal communities is extensive and he is excited to show you the beautiful opportunities that these areas provide.


Joe’s passion to help others has led him to helping people find a dream home that they can call their own. He is dedicated to helping you with all your real estate needs and to share his passion for coastal Downeast Maine and beyond.
